  • NAO-2023-00286 (Wishing Star Substation, Loudoun County, Virginia)

    Expiration date: 5/23/2023

    Virginia Electric and Power Company proposes to construct two power substations adjacent to an existing transmission line within the Broad Run drainage area in Loudoun County, Virginia. The activities will impact 0.17 acres of forested wetlands, 0.02 acres of emergent wetlands, 449 square feet of grading along the bank of a perennial stream (Broad Run), and 791 linear feet of intermittent stream associated with the substation footprints as well as a proposed stormwater management facility. In compliance with regulations implementing Section 106 of the NHPA, the Corps is soliciting comments on the proposed project from the public; federal, state, and local agencies and officials; Native American Tribes; and other interested parties. This public notice provides an opportunity for members of the public to express their views on the undertaking’s effects on historic properties and resolution of adverse effects. The Corps is requesting comments to assist in evaluation of the effects of the project on historic properties and evaluation of alternatives or modifications which could avoid, minimize, or mitigate adverse effects on historic properties. Public comments should be received by the close of business on June 22, 2023.

  • NAO-2020-01573 (DWC Holdings, Loudoun, Virginia)

    Expiration date: 12/21/2022

    DWC Holdings, LLC is proposing Phase I of the proposed Rivana at Innovation Station project to construct a mixed-use development providing a walkable urban center connecting to a future Metro station in Loudoun County, Virginia. Phase I will include with 250,000 square feet of office space, 2,000 residential units, a 265-room hotel, and communal open space. Phase II of the project includes 1,185 linear feet of stream restoration associated with a tributary of Horsepen Run within the western portion of the project area. The project is located northeast and adjacent to the Dulles Greenway (State Routes 267) and Sully Road (Route 28) interchange and is bounded to the north and southeast by Innovation Avenue; the former Innovation Avenue currently bisects the study area in Loudoun County, Virginia.
